1.4" Ordovician Starfish (Petraster?) Fossil - Morocco
This is a 1.4" wide, Ordovician aged starfish of the genus Petraster. It comes from the Tioririne Formation near Blekus, Morocco. The specimen shows an amazing amount of detail and the natural, orange coloration is due to the oxidization of iron pyrite.
There are multiple repairs through the rock where it was broken during extraction. One of these cracks went through a ray and looks to have had some minor surface restoration. Another ray has a crack through it, though there is no indication of restoration here.
